Well tonight I put the thing together, lubed up and gave it a gentle, slow try. I have to say after just one session I can already see where this has promise. The vacuum created in the tube causes the penis to expand and fill with blood in a healthy way that it just won't do anymore since being injured. While pumping up if I watch carefully I can see right when the scar tissue starts to affect the erection and make it lean which is my cue to go easy on the pressure. The VED also creates much more girth and length than a natural erection and the appearance of my penis in the tube while under pressure is much fuller and straighter than a "natural erection" with much less hour glass effect. Obviously I am a complete newbie rookie but after just 15 minutes of gentle experimentation this strange plastic device that was freaking me out has given me a spark of hope. I've been doing the VED therapy for about 2 weeks now and today I also had my first appointment with my new urologist at The Mayo Clinic in Rochester, MN. First let me state that very early in my VED sessions I learned that it is a fine line between enough and too much stimulation/suction. I liked what I could see happening inside the tube and got a bit too aggressive in one of my first attempts which did cause some pain in the penis right next to the area where my plaque is most prevalent. Seems "stretching" needs to be done very slowly and carefully. I have been much more careful since that incident with better results. I have constant irritation whether flaccid and/or erect, but not usually what I would consider "pain", but this was pain...no doubt about it. After a good VED session my flaccid penis looks almost normal in girth again even though it still curves to the left. The curve in my erections hasn't gotten better but it's still early in the process and I'm still learning.

The appointment with the urologist at The Mayo Clinic was refreshing because I finally feel confident that I have finally found a doctor with experience in treating Peyronies. But let me be perfectly clear that even though the man seemed educated and experienced he didn't teach me anything I didn't already know. Basically my new doctor just confirmed everything you guys on this forum have been telling me. I don't know anything this evening that I didn't know this morning but I feel more confident than ever that you guys are an invaluable resource in fighting this awful condition. So after confirming that I have a large plaque between the size of nickle here's what my new doctor said to do:

1. Stop using the topical Verapamil, it is probably worthless. (Even though I despise the stuff I may continue it anyway since I have a valid prescription. It may not help but I doubt it can hurt and who knows....).
2. He gave me prescription for Cialis.
3. He gave me a prescription for Pentox. (Finally!!!).
4. He told me to continue with the VED therapy! (He really seemed to believe in this! He thinks a guy should use it 6 out of every 7 days which I don't recall being discussed here but I might have over-looked).
5. He told me to continue with the supplements if I want (Ubiquinol, Vitamin E, L-Arginine, Fish Oil, Multi Vitamin).

He told me to follow the above program for 1 year before judging the results. He did stress that it probably would have been much better had I started all this within the 1st year of contracting the condition and he honestly didn't think there was much hope for significant improvement in my case because of the length of time I have been hiding it and living with it. Okay! My turn! I can basically second everything Knight said in his first post, but some different impressions as well.

I received the Augusta manual pump single cylinder - aka "vitality OTC" three days ago.
This is the cheapest medical grade VED I am aware of, and is the one often recommended on these forums.
Thanks to Old Man for all the help so far! First off,

Background: My scars are soft, and in multiple places half way up on underside of my shaft causing an upward bent and slight hourglassing. I am 26,this started 2 years ago but had symptoms since 19 or 20.

Like other's, my initial and first use of the VED yielded immediate results that have lasted ever since I started it.
My first impressions are these:

-fuller penis / no more "hard flaccid"
-lessening of hinge and hour glassing like I've never seen before
-Subsequently, urine stream improvement
-Erections induced afterwards feel and look more like old times; solid and whole, not segmented and weak!
-Small but visible improvement of dent and hour glassing
--And most importantly, I can finally ejaculate normally. This is a god send. I can actually enjoy orgasm now, since ejaculation no longer results in blood leaving the penis and a transient priaprism / bending. For years this, I have theorized, has been the cause of my peyronies. Constant bending always after ejaculation. Even a single kegel while flaccid would always result in bending and hinging. If I kegel now while flaccid, my penis does not even move. This is simply outstanding for me.

The VED has seemed to solidified my penis already, and evened out the blood flow.

It's inspiring to read these success stories. They are an oasis of hope in a sea of desperation.

The VED alone is a critical tool in restoring functionality to our penises. Without VED, my penis remains tight and smaller. But when I do VED every day, my penis hangs fuller and my erections are better.

As I've mentioned, a protocol of VED, traction, Pentox, and Cialis is the bedrock of therapy for this plague. Looking beyond those, making sure your testosterone is at the high-normal range and that you are eating a diet of high protein and low carbs and getting a good amount of exercise is important as well.

Here's how I would rank the various treatments:


First Tier:

(1) VED (Thanks to Old Man for his research and his advice on the proper use of the VED for Peyronie's)
(2) Traction (4+ hours/day is essential. Wear it as long as you can for maximum results)
(3) Pentox (400 mg/3x per day minimum)
(4) Cialis (I take 5 mg/day for maintenance but sometimes skip a day to insure my body doesn't get used to it)


Second Tier:

(1) Testosterone (Including supplements to raise testosterone (D-Aspartic Acid) and nitric oxide (L-Arginine or preferably Citrulline))
(2) High protein/low carb diet (protein is essential in building and repairing muscle while carbs can make you gain weight and slow you down)
(3) Exercise (focus on low reps with heavy weight since that creates more testosterone)


Third Tier:

(1) PRP treatment or (Priapus Shot) (typically about $1,800. One shot is all you need but you can get another shot in about 3 mos.)
(2) HGH (you can get it for less than $500/month)
(3) Stem cell treatment (typically about $5,000)


Fourth Tier:

(1) Experimental processes, including peptides (This tier would be skipped until these processes are shown to have some degree of efficacy)


Fifth Tier:

(1) Surgery, either to fix the bend or get an implant. (The ideal implant is the AMS 700 LGX because it expands in both length and girth giving the penis a natural, full appearance. Thanks to Jackp for bringing it to our attention.)


And please, no smoking!! That's how I got Peyronie's.


In conclusion, if I could have only one form of treatment, it would be VED, hands down.

I was going to take a short break to heal but I went ahead and used the VED for 15 minutes tonight. (I did skip last night to heal a bit) Tonight I went at it very easy by slowly working up to about 4 pumps max where as previously I would go as high as 6 or 7 pumps. I know "pumps" is not a very accurate way to judge the amount of force any one individual may be placing on their penises, but it's all we've got and it does offer some idea of the ultimate pressure. Besides using less over all force I kept the holds short and then slowly pumped back up by doing 2 pumps, pause, 1/2 pump, pause, 1/2 pump pause, (and so on) release, pause and repeat. All in all I was much less aggressive on the "stretch" I placed on my damaged tissues and so far it seems to have stimulated a natural pump with no further pain or irritation (although I always have some irritation anyway, it just doesn't seem worse). Whereas before I would slowly work up to a pretty aggressive erection in the tube, tonight I never made myself get completely hard. I'm just testing the waters so to speak. I'm thinking being this cautious every time may not have an over all positive effect (not enough stretch) but I have to learn proper stimulation without annihilating myself!   :o

I'm not sure if this would be proper therapy under normal circumstances or if what I was doing before I got hurt was proper, or something in between is the ticket but at this point working up slowly is the way I will proceed and monitor for pain and/or irritation. If I have to take a break I will, I just want to be sure as to not waste any time.

I'm just throwing this out there for feedback and to help other newbies find the best way to perform VED therapy without risking further damage.

Where my plaque is, and as hard as it is, I'm not sure these tissues are ever going to be elastic again without a miracle. How much "stretch" I can get out of the surrounding tissues seems to be the key to compensating and correcting the curvature. Is my theory correct or false in your opinions?

Knight,

I think Old Man and the others will agree that less is more, and that a full pump is not necessary at all. Even partial "engorging" is hugely beneficial. There are studies demonstrating a massive increase in oxygen levels in the penis after one use. And the scar will be stretched, or rather blood will be forced to enter the small areas of the penis it couldn't before. I do not believe it's just a matter of stretching the scar, but rather about getting the blood into the small damaged areas of the penis. :)
